The PartyPoker.com Sports Stars Challenge has drawn to a close and it's snooker that has the bragging rights as Ken Doherty won through against other stars from the world of sport.
37-year old Doherty proved that he had mastered a different kind of table at the recent PartyPoker.com Sports Stars Challenge. The was on cue to sink his fellow sportsmen and chalk up a cool £20,000 pot for his efforts.
After battling through a tough snooker heat that included Steve Davis, boosted by success at the 2006 WSOP, Doherty found himself lining up his shots on a final table that included ex-England football international Ray Parlour, England cricket star Robert Key, current Australian rugby league international Brad Drew, as well as the greatest darts player of all time, Phil “The Power” Taylor.
